Originally from France, Astrid Adverbe was born in Madagascar and grew up in the West Indies. Coming from the theatre, she has starred in several films by Paul Vecchiali, including Nuits blances sur la jetée, C’est l’amour, Les 7 déserteurs (FICX 2017) or Train de vies (FICX 2018).
